服务器虚拟内存的初始大小设置对系统性能和稳定性至关重要,以下是关于如何合理设置服务器虚拟内存初始大小的详细解答:
一、确定虚拟内存的大小
1、物理内存与虚拟内存的比例:
虚拟内存的大小通常应设置为物理内存的1.5倍到2倍,如果服务器有16GB的物理内存,则虚拟内存可以设置为24GB到32GB。
这种比例可以确保在物理内存不足时,有足够的虚拟内存来支持系统的正常运行,避免因内存不足而导致的系统崩溃或性能下降。
2、考虑服务器的实际负载:
根据服务器上运行的应用程序和工作负载来确定虚拟内存的大小,如果服务器需要处理大量数据或运行多个高内存消耗的应用程序,可能需要增加虚拟内存的大小。
二、设置虚拟内存的初始大小和最大大小
1、初始大小:
将初始大小设置为物理内存的1.5倍是一个常见的建议,对于16GB的物理内存,初始大小可以设置为24GB。
初始大小应该足够大,以满足服务器正常运行时的内存需求。
2、最大大小:
最大大小可以根据服务器的需求来设定,但通常建议设置为物理内存的2倍或3倍,对于16GB的物理内存,最大大小可以设置为32GB或48GB。
最大大小是虚拟内存的上限,确保系统不会超出可用的硬盘空间。
三、设置虚拟内存的位置
如果服务器有多个物理硬盘,考虑将虚拟内存放在不同的硬盘上,以提高性能,这样可以减少磁盘I/O竞争。
选择磁盘性能较好、可靠性较高的硬盘来存放虚拟内存文件。
四、监控和调整
定期监控系统资源使用情况,特别是内存的使用情况,如果发现系统频繁使用虚拟内存而不是物理内存,可能需要考虑升级物理内存或优化系统配置。
根据实际运行情况,适时调整虚拟内存的大小和位置,以确保系统能够在最佳状态下运行。
五、注意事项
在设置虚拟内存之前,请确保了解服务器的硬件配置和使用需求,并参考相关的文档或专业人士的建议进行设置。
避免将虚拟内存设置得过小或过大,以免造成系统不稳定或浪费资源。
在调整虚拟内存后,建议重启服务器以使更改生效。
合理设置服务器虚拟内存的初始大小是保证服务器稳定运行的重要步骤之一,通过根据物理内存大小、服务器负载以及实际运行情况来确定虚拟内存的大小、初始大小和最大大小,并将其放置在合适的位置,可以显著提高服务器的性能和稳定性,定期监控和调整虚拟内存的设置也是非常重要的。
以上就是关于“服务器虚拟内存初始大小设置”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!
文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/13296.html<